    I went to dinner with my Mom and some other women who are in a women's motorcycle club together, last week. When dinner came, I noticed the woman across the table had removed the bun from her veggie burger. Seems her doctor put her on a low fat/low carb diet due to high cholesterol. My Mom chimed in and told her about how she did Atkins and lowered her cholesterol and lost weight. But that's not the point of my post.

    While we chatted, she mentioned that ever since her gall bladder was removed, she has had ongoing issues with her weight. Well, this rang a bell with me. I had mine removed in 2003 and afterwards, was never able (until Atkins) to lose weight.. only gained it. I was curious if others on this board have had the same problem. I've also had issues with constant loose and bright yellow stools. Only after following this WOE did my color return to normal.. Sorry if this is TMI, but weightloss causes lots o' poopies.. lol!
